Notice of Laxp Office Cancellation Hearing
U.S. Laxp Office Lamar Colorado schedules a cancellation hearing for Mary Garret Byron Garrett and Lila Garrett regarding Homestead Entry No. 1a in Township 10 North Range 2 West Prowers County with cultivation or residence alleged. The defendants must appear October 10 at 10 o clock a.m. to present testimony.

Timber Culture Alias Notice in Lamar Colorado
Impla int filed by B J Sapp against William L Reitmnger over timber culture entry No 478 dated March 30 159 for northeast quarter section 10 township 8 south range 42 west Prowers county Colorado seeking cancellation. Contestants allege failure to cultivate crop plant trees seeds or cuttings for fifth and sixth years. Parties summoned to appear October 10 at 9 o'clock to respond.

Republicans sweep courts and states with only Prowers county rebuff
The report notes broad GOP gains across Colorado and several Northern states, with Mississippi and Prowers county as notable exceptions. It mentions Funderburg losing in Kiowa, Ohio voting for governor, New Jersey and Kentucky boosting GOP majorities, and forecasts a Republican controlled Senate.
